Output eb695b7904f155bed48e6902d4a2b6f352f2e9b575db5fbee02c66abddc2ca02:0

value
8568150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f52f2d495ac21a514331c91503260ba0552b3c1 OP_EQUAL
address
3AP3V8kHRkj25P8DMWs7ygewgV5boBP5Kb
transaction
eb695b7904f155bed48e6902d4a2b6f352f2e9b575db5fbee02c66abddc2ca02
spent
true